Nano-Banana’s Breakthrough Capabilities

Nano-Banana, quietly introduced on LMArena’s Image Edit Arena, has stunned users with its ability to interpret complex text prompts for seamless image edits. Unlike traditional tools requiring masking or layering, it handles tasks like “turn the person into a medieval knight while keeping the background intact” with one-shot precision, generating results in 3–5 seconds at 1MP resolution. Its strengths include character consistency, preserving facial details across edits, and scene blending, ensuring natural lighting and context. Social media posts on X praise its “insane accuracy,” with one user noting, “It’s like Photoshop, but smarter and faster.”

Outshining the Competition

Compared to FLUX Kontext, a leading model known for reliable image fusion, Nano-Banana demonstrates superior prompt comprehension and visual coherence. It excels in multi-element edits, such as swapping characters or transforming scenes into styles like photorealism or watercolor, while maintaining high-resolution quality. Early testers report it “destroys” competitors in preserving details during complex tasks like face completion or background changes. Although its architecture remains undisclosed, speculation points to advanced multimodal algorithms, possibly linked to Google’s Gemini or Imagen models, though no developer has confirmed its origins.

Challenges and Future Potential

Despite its prowess, Nano-Banana faces challenges like occasional logic glitches or struggles with rendering hands and in-image text, common AI limitations. Its preview status on LMArena, with inconsistent access, frustrates some users, per X posts. If integrated into platforms like FluxProWeb or Google’s Pixel 10, as speculated, it could redefine on-device editing with real-time, high-fidelity results.
